You have to watch on aluminum. Oil eater, certain other cleaners will oxidize the hell out of it. Most of what I clean is aluminum cases.
 
Then if you do not rinse right away though ugly steel cases will rust fast also. No real in between for me yet. Will play with this first with straight simple green. Carb guys use it alot. Want to stay water based. Others very hard to dispose of around here.
